"Naphthazarin" is a word in ENGLISH

naphthazarin ENGLISH
Definition:

A dyestuff, resembling alizarin, obtained from
naphthoquinone as a red crystalline substance with a bright green,
metallic luster; -- called also naphthalizarin.
